Top 5 PVP Games on iOS in Belarus Q1 2023
Explore the performance of the top 5 PVP games on iOS in Belarus during Q1 2023, including trends in down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the first quarter of 2023, the top 5 PVP games on iOS in Belarus showed varied performance in terms of we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. According to data from Sensor Tower, here’s a detailed look at how these games fared.
Mobile Legends: Bang Bang from Shanghai Moonton Technology Co., Ltd. saw its weekly revenue fluctuate throughout the quarter, peaking at approximately $3.3K in the final week of January. Weekly downloads remained relatively steady, with minor dips and peaks, averaging around 850 downloads per week. Weekly active users showed a slight decrease from 12K to 12.2K by the end of March.
PUBG MOBILE by Tencent Mobile International Limited experienced growth in both weekly revenue and active users. Revenue peaked at $2.6K in mid-March, while downloads saw a slight decline from 1.6K to 1.2K per week. Active users increased significantly, reaching 28.1K by the end of March.
Roblox from Roblox Corporation maintained consistent revenue, with a peak of $1.9K in early January. Weekly downloads averaged around 1.3K, with a notable peak at 1.7K in the first week of January. Active users remained stable, hovering around 18K throughout the quarter.
Genshin Impact by COGNOSPHERE PTE. LTD. experienced fluctuations in weekly revenue, peaking at $2.4K at the end of December and dropping to $642 in early March. Downloads started strong with 950 in mid-January but declined to around 560 by mid-March. Active users showed a slight decline from 11K to 8.8K over the quarter.
Standoff 2 from AXLEBOLT LTD saw its weekly revenue peak at $1.7K in mid-March. Weekly downloads rose significantly, reaching 2.4K in early March. Active users remained robust, increasing from 23K to 28K by the end of March.
